%N Table read by downward antidiagonals: ranked maximum r likelihood of the number of distinguishable marbles in an urn if repeated random sampling of one marble with replacement yields n different marbles before the first repeated marble.

%e Table T(n,r) begins:

%e n\r | 1 2 3 4 5 6 7 8 9 10 11

%e ----+-------------------------------------------

%e 1 | 1, 1, 1, 1, 1, 1, 1, 1, 1, 1, 1

%e 2 | 2, 3, 4, 5, 6, 7, 8, 9, 10, 11, 12

%e 3 | 5, 4, 6, 7, 8, 9, 3, 10, 11, 12, 13

%e 4 | 8, 9, 10, 7, 11, 12, 6, 13, 14, 15, 16

%e 5 | 13, 14, 12, 15, 11, 16, 17, 10, 18, 19, 20

%e 6 | 19, 18, 20, 17, 21, 22, 16, 23, 24, 15, 25

%e 7 | 25, 26, 27, 24, 28, 23, 29, 22, 30, 31, 21

%e 8 | 33, 34, 32, 35, 31, 36, 30, 37, 38, 29, 39

%e 9 | 42, 41, 43, 40, 44, 39, 45, 46, 38, 47, 37

%e 10 | 51, 52, 50, 53, 54, 49, 55, 48, 56, 47, 57

%e 11 | 62, 63, 61, 64, 60, 65, 59, 66, 58, 67, 57

%e 12 | 74, 73, 75, 72, 76, 71, 77, 70, 78, 79, 69

%e 13 | 86, 87, 85, 88, 84, 89, 90, 83, 91, 82, 92

%t l[n_, r_] := l[n, r] = Table[Product[(M - i + 1)/M, {i, 2, n}]*n/M, {M, 2, n^2*r}];

%t T[1, r_] = 1; T[n_, r_] := T[n, r] = Module[{pos}, pos = Position[l[n, r], RankedMax[l[n, r], r]]; If[Length[pos] == 0, -1, pos[[1, 1]] + 1]];

%t (*Table*)Table[T[n, r], {n, 1, 13}, {r, 1, 11}] // TableForm

%t (*Data*)Table[T[n, r - n + 1], {r, 1, 12}, {n, 1, r}] // Flatten

%Y Cf. A111097 (column 1).

%Y Cf. A000012 (row 1), A000027 (row 2).
